What has more kick 30-06 or 270?

The . 270 shoots flatter and produces less recoil and is therefore theoretically better suited to open plains hunting and smaller game. The . 30-06 has more energy, especially up close, and hits with more authority, making it better suited for bear, elk, moose and the larger African plains game.

Does a 270 kick hard?

A . 270 Winchester with a 140-grain bullet traveling at 3,000 fps generates 17.1 pounds of recoil using an 8-pound rifle. That’s a 4.5-pound increase in recoil, or roughly 36 percent, with a gain of only 140 fps.

How much does a 270 drop at 100 yards?

270 Winchester ~ 140 Grain ~ Trajectory Chart

Range (Yards) Velocity (Ft/Sec) Bullet Path (inches)
100 2774.3 1.51
200 2595.4 0.0
300 2389.1 -6.7
400 2192.2 -19.51

Is 270 enough for elk?

270, especially when mated with the tough, deep-penetrating, weight-retaining bullets we have today, is not a “big gun” on elk, but is adequate for any elk that walks, with careful shot placement.

Will a 12-gauge slug stop a grizzly?

It is a common misconception that shotgun ammunition is a good way to chase away a bear. In reality, target or bird-hunting shot is an ineffective solution that often leads to unnecessary outcomes. Bears have relatively thin skin and shotgun ammunition can be extremely harmful and even lethal.
